Kher Gaon is a Rural village located in Chaubatta-khal, Pauri-garhwal, Uttarakhand.

The total population of Kher Gaon is 131.

Kher Gaon village comprises 35 households.

The literacy rate in Kher Gaon is 80.7%. Among the literate population of 92, there are 44 literate males and 48 literate females.

In Kher Gaon, there are 56 males and 75 females, with a sex ratio of 1339 females per 1000 males.

There are 17 children (13% of population), comprising 9 boys and 8 girls.

The total number of workers in Kher Gaon is 69, with 11 main workers and 58 marginal workers.

In Kher Gaon, there are 8 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(4 males, 4 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Kher Gaon is located in Uttarakhand state, Pauri-garhwal district, and falls under Chaubatta-khal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 48200 and LGD code is 48200.
